Abstract

The P2 configuration plug-in hybrid electric vehicle (P2-PHEV) equipped with a multi-speed transmission has a high potential for recovering more regenerative energy, as the shifting strategy can be employed to adjust the working zone of the electric motor (EM). However, the existing shifting strategy designed for normal driving conditions cannot achieve optimal regenerative energy recovery. In this study, a shifting strategy used in the regenerative braking process is proposed. First, to make the EM provide more regenerative force during braking, a braking force distribution algorithm is devised while simultaneously considering braking stability and safety. Second, to realize maximum regenerative braking energy recovery, an optimal shifting strategy is designed for regenerative braking. Third, the classical braking process is analyzed and six thresholds are abstracted and optimized to establish a rule for restraining frequent gearshifts raised in the proposed optimal shifting strategy. Finally, the proposed strategy is verified under three standard cycles, results show that the proposed shifting strategy can recover considerable regenerative energy without frequent gearshifts.
